NEW DELHI — Indian men’s singles badminton cornerstone Lakshya Sen enters a critical phase of international competition as he prepares for upcoming continental commitments. As one of India’s most lethal and technically accomplished shuttlers, the Almora-born athlete remains a central figure in the nation's multi-sport ambitions. However, official reports and sports analysts emphasize that his most formidable hurdle is overcoming psychological blocks, maintaining on-court emotional regulation, and breaking through high-pressure match lapses.
Performance Trajectory and Current Form
The journey for Lakshya Sen has been defined by extreme highs and testing physical challenges, including an extensive recovery period following a deviated septum surgery. According to sports body updates and tournament trackers from the Badminton World Federation (BWF), Sen has shown flashes of brilliance interspersed with frustrating early exits.
While his technical repertoire—featuring precise net play, exceptional court coverage, and a deceptive jump smash—remains elite, maintaining physical and mental stamina through late tournament rounds has proven challenging. Official BWF rankings place him among the competitive tier of world badminton, yet converting deep tournament runs into championship titles requires bridging the gap between strategic execution and psychological consistency under pressure.
Mental Resilience as the Ultimate Barrier
Sports psychologists and coaching staff observing elite Indian shuttlers note that high-stakes matches often amplify unforced errors when players overthink tactical adaptations. For Sen, tactical brilliance is frequently undermined by moments of impatience during prolonged rallies.
According to event organizers and coaching team assessments, high-performance training camps have specifically targeted stress-management techniques, energy conservation across multi-game battles, and tactical discipline during crucial points. Addressing these mental barriers is vital as he shoulders heavy expectations from fans and national selectors aiming for podium sweeps at major multi-sport events.

What are Lakshya Sen’s primary strengths on the badminton court?
Sen is widely recognized for his exceptional speed, tight net play, deceptive clears, and relentless defensive retrievals that tire out top-tier opponents.
Why is mental consistency highlighted as his biggest battle?
Analysts note that while Sen possesses the technical skill to beat any player globally, lapses in concentration during critical game junctures often lead to avoidable unforced errors and premature exits.
How do high-intensity schedules affect elite shuttlers?
The packed BWF calendar leaves minimal recovery time, forcing players like Sen to balance heavy tournament loads with injury prevention and mental fatigue management.
